Karimnagar: The Telangana State Cooperative Apex Bank (TSCAB) Managing Director Dr Nethi Muralidhar explained to the officials of Karimnagar District Cooperative Central Bank about the implementation of the Banking Regulation Act and the formation of a separate Ministry for Cooperation in the Union Cabinet.
Welcoming the BR Act and the constitution of the Union Ministry for Cooperation, he said it was a welcome sign for the growth of cooperatives in the country. Similarly, the DCCB officials should also comply with the amended provisions of the BR Act and gear up for the changing challenges as they fall under the regulatory framework of the RBI, he stated.
Dr Muralidhar, who was in town to take part in a private programme on Monday, visited the Karimangar DCCB and interacted with the officials. Praising the bank for its steady growth and performance and winning accolades in the country, he appreciated the bank staff for their team and achieving several national awards including the best cooperative bank in the country from NABARD.
Calling upon the bank officials to strive hard to achieve the target of doing business of Rs 5,000 crore during the financial year, he stressed the need for the diversification of business activities. Quoting the example of the diversification of PACS into multi-service centers, he also informed the bankers to focus on extending loans to the farmer producer companies (FPO). KDCCB CEO N Satyanarayana Rao, general manager B Sridhar and others were also present.
